Basic Concepts of Fuel Pump Solenoids

A Fuel Pump Solenoid is an electromechanical device that controls the flow of fuel within a truck’s fuel system. Its primary function is to regulate the delivery of fuel to the engine by opening and closing a valve in response to electrical signals. This operation ensures that the engine receives the precise amount of fuel needed for optimal performance under varying conditions. The solenoid operates through a plunger mechanism that moves in response to the magnetic field generated by an electric current, thereby controlling the fuel flow 1.

Troubleshooting Common Issues with Fuel Pump Solenoids

Identifying and addressing common problems associated with Fuel Pump Solenoids is important for maintaining the truck’s performance. Symptoms of solenoid failure may include engine misfires, difficulty starting the engine, or a decrease in fuel efficiency. Diagnostic procedures may involve testing the electrical connections, checking for proper operation of the solenoid valve, and ensuring that the solenoid receives the correct electrical signals. Potential solutions range from cleaning the solenoid and its connections to replacing the solenoid if it is found to be faulty.

Function with Fuel Shutoff

In systems equipped with a Fuel Shutoff mechanism, the Fuel Pump Solenoid is responsible for initiating the shutoff sequence. When the solenoid receives a signal to shut off the fuel, it engages the shutoff valve, stopping the fuel flow to the engine. This function is vital for safety, allowing the engine to be quickly and effectively shut down in emergency situations or during maintenance procedures.
